Beware - Gas mileage dropped over 13%

The LTX M/S 2's are the 5th set of Michelins I have purchased for my various vehicles - 3 other sets beng LTX M/S and the orginal Michelin A/S tires, that these new LTX M/S 2's replaced. They went on a 2010 Ford F150 Crew Cab that I use for business. The priginal A/S tires lasted 92,000 miles which I thought was good. As you can tell by the year and the mileage, I put between 45,000- 50,000 miles per year on the vehicle so a good set of tires is important and I always thought the Michelin tires to be the best value - lowest cost per mile to run. I wanted to replace the A/S tires with another set of A/S tires but was told by the dealer that they were "unavailable". He spoke of the LTX M/S 2's so I went ahead and got the set. Never did I realize that there would be an affect on gas mileage. I keep very detailed records of my miles and fuel consumed and, to the date of install of the new tires my fuel mileage, under the same driving condions, dropped over 13% or 2.7 MPG. Assuming the same tread wear on these that I had on the orginal A/S tires , my fuel cost is going to increase by $2200 over the life of the tire. Any value gained by the longer trad life is lost five-fold due to the decreased fuel efficiency. Unfortuneatley I did not realize the effect untril after the 30 day warranty ran out or I would have returned the tires. I expected a slight change in the fuel efficiency with the more aggressive tread , but not anything near this drastic.

Good Long Term Investment $

Possibly the best light duty truck tire on the market. The first set of LTX M / S2 performed so well we purchased a second set after 60,000 miles. Traction is exceptional in all types of weather even in snow on a 2WD pickup truck. Ride is much smoother than most other tires in the same class. Tread wear is consistent across the tread pattern which helps maintain a comfortable ride for many miles. Tires preform well as far as handling and these tires appear to be quieter then most other brands. Good investment if you need a dependable tire that performs well in all conditions.
